Kinds Of Exercise Bikes
When searching for a stationary bicycle, it's necessary to comprehend the various types offered. Each type provides special functions that cater to numerous workout choices. Below is a breakdown of the primary classifications:
Type of BikeDescriptionPerfect ForUpright BikeLooks like a traditional bicycle; user sits upright.Those who choose a biking feel.Recumbent BikeFunctions a larger seat and back-rest; user leans back.Individuals with back problems or those looking for convenience.Spin BikeCreated for high-intensity interval training; provides a flywheel for a smooth ride.Bicyclists and fitness enthusiasts going for intense workouts.Air BikeResistance increases with pedaling intensity; features handlebars for upper body workout.Users wanting full-body workouts and varied intensity.Hybrid BikeIntegrates components of upright and recumbent bikes.Users wanting flexibility in seating and riding position.Secret Features to Consider
When searching for a stationary bicycle, several functions can enhance your workout experience. Below is a list of important features to consider:

Resistance Levels: Bikes can use magnetic, friction, or air resistance. Magnetic resistance is normally quieter and needs less maintenance.

Show Console: A good exercise bike display screen should reveal essential workout metrics such as time, distance, speed, calories burned, and heart rate.

Adjustability: Consider bikes that enable you to adjust the seat height and handlebar position to guarantee appropriate ergonomics.

Weight Capacity: Ensure the bike can support your weight; most bikes have weight limitations ranging from 250 to 400 pounds.

Mobility: Some bikes feature wheels for simple movement, which can be helpful if area is restricted.

Rate: Exercise bikes can range from affordable designs to high-end alternatives. Identify your budget in advance to narrow your options.

Guarantee: A strong service warranty can supply peace of mind concerning your financial investment, specifically for bikes with complex electronics.
Assessing Your Space
Before buying, it's vital to examine your offered area. Measure the location where you plan to put the bike, accounting for space for motion. Here's a simple table to assist visualize the space you will need for various kinds of bikes:
Type of BikeMinimum Space Required (L x W)Recommended Space (L x W)Upright Bike4' x 2'6' x 4'Recumbent Bike4' x 2.5'6' x 5'Spin Bike4' x 2'6' x 4'Air Bike4.5' x 2'6' x 4'Hybrid Bike4' x 2.5'6' x 4.5'Budgeting for Your Exercise Bike

How much should I invest in an exercise bike?
The quantity you invest depends upon your budget and preferences. Entry-level bikes begin around ₤ 200, while high-end designs can increase to ₤ 2,500 or more.
2. Do I need a bike with digital features?
Digital features can boost your workout experience, supplying tracking and exercise programs. However, if your focus is purely on pedaling, a fundamental bike can suffice.
3. Are Exercise bikes (higgins-johannsen.technetbloggers.de) appropriate for weight-loss?
Yes, exercise bikes can be a reliable tool for weight reduction when integrated with a balanced diet plan. Routine biking helps burn calories and construct cardiovascular endurance.
4. How often should I utilize my exercise bike?
For general physical fitness, biking three to 5 times per week for 30-60 minutes is recommended. Change based on your fitness level and goals.
5. What are the advantages of using a stationary bicycle?
Utilizing a stationary bicycle can enhance cardiovascular health, construct lower body strength, enhance state of mind, and provide a low-impact exercise choice, making it ideal for various physical fitness levels.
